Blackberry and apple crumble
200 g | blackberries |
750 g | Granny Smith apples |
½ tsp | cinnamon |
4 tbsp | flour |
75 g | soft brown sugar |
50 g | walnuts, chopped |
75 g | chilled unsalted butter, cubed |
50 g | oats |
Peel, core and chop the apple into 2cm pieces. |
Preheat the oven to 160°C (fan). In a large bowl, mix the fruit with the cinnamon, 1tbsp of the flour and 1tbsp of the brown sugar. Pour into a small baking dish. |
In a medium bowl, combine the remaining brown sugar, flour, nuts, butter and oats. Use your fingers to work the butter through but keep it chunky. Scatter the topping over the fruit and bake for 45 minutes until golden. Serve warm, with ice cream or crème fraîche. |
